Add 28/75 and 42/80
28/75 + 42/80 is 539/600.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 75 and 80 is 1200
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1200 - For the 1st fraction, since 75 × 16 = 1200,
28/75 = 28 × 16/75 × 16 = 448/1200 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 80 × 15 = 1200,
42/80 = 42 × 15/80 × 15 = 630/1200 - Add the two like fractions:
448/1200 + 630/1200 = 448 + 630/1200 = 1078/1200 - 1078/1200 simplified gives 539/600
- So, 28/75 + 42/80 = 539/600
